Coughing up blood or hemoptysis is spitting blood from the throat, lungs, airway passage, nose, mouth, and stomach. The blood is dark red or rusty. So, is coughing up blood poisonous? Well, coughing up blood could be mild, moderate, and fatal, depending upon their causes. It is massive hemoptysis if the coughing up blood is more than 600ml during 24 hours (deadly). It is only 5% but causes 80 % of deaths. Then what should you do if you see a person coughing up blood? Let’s check out coughing-up blood home remedies.

What causes coughing up blood?

Coughing up blood could be due to different issues that range from mild to severe. Following are some serious haemoptysis causes:

  • Pneumonia
  • Bronchiectasis-short of breath due to enlargement of arteries
  • Blood clotting in lungs
  • Prolonged violent cough
  • Chest infection or Trauma due to a car accident
  • Parasitic infection
  • Tuberculosis
  • Some form of Congestive heart failure
  • lungs cancer
  • Blood vessels inflammation (vacuities)
  • Inhaling foreign particles such as food leads to ruptured airway
  • Use of anticoagulants (blood thinner) such as warfarin.
  • Use crack cocaine that also causes coughing up blood

Commonly, haemoptysis causes are associated with symptoms, and they need an accurate diagnosis. When to see a Hakeem (physician) if you’re coughing up blood symptoms?

Diagnosing specific causes of coughing up blood can be challenging. If a person doesn’t smoke but coughs up with some blood, it could be a mild infection. In young and healthy people coughing up is not a severe problem If there is little blood with mucus for less than a week. It’s Probably a mild infection. Very often, such infection triggers prolonged violent coughing that ruptures tiny blood vessels. One of the most common causes for coughing up blood. It indicates some severe medical conditions in case of these symptoms as:

  • If the blood lasts for more than a week and getting severe overtime
  • Chest pain and Trauma
  • High fever
  • Shortness of breath and rapid breathing
  • Unexplained weight loss

7 Home Remedies for Coughing Up blood treatment

Several ways for coughing up blood treatment:

Treatment of hemoptysis depends on the causes, and it is necessary to notify the physician. Blood treatment tinged sputum includes:

  • Oral antibiotics to tackle pneumonia or tuberculosis
  • Antiviral to reduce the length of the virus
  • Surgery to treat a blood clot in case of persistent hemoptysis
  • Chemotherapy need for lungs cancer treatment
  • Steroids are prescribed to treat inflammation

7 Home Remedies for Coughing Up blood treatment:

Let’s talk about coughing up blood home remedies for you: Salt has the property of anti-germs. Add 1/2 (half) teaspoon of salt in warm water, mix it well, and gargle 2 to 3 times a day. It’ll kill the germs and soothe your sore throat.

  • Garlic is a source of sulfur that is against bacteria and prevents infection. So take three cloves of raw garlic at night before going to bed or chop it, mix it with honey and let it sit overnight. Take one teaspoon twice a day. This remedy will prevent blood and reduce phlegm production. Thus soon, you will get relief.
  • Honey is naturally effective in getting rid of coughing up blood. It has anti-inflammation, antiviral and antibacterial properties that soothe the throat. Add two teaspoons of honey in half a teaspoon of ginger juice or your regular tea. Try this remedy twice a day will help a lot when suffering from hemoptysis.
  • Take two teaspoons of grape juice and honey. Now mix it well and use this remedy three times a day.
  • Prepare a mixture of ginger juice with half a teaspoon of cinnamon and cloves in a cup of hot water. Drink this mixture for a few days. Moreover, one can make an herbal tea by using one teaspoon of ginger powder and half a teaspoon
  • of black pepper in boiling water. Stepping it for a few minutes and then adding some honey. It’s a very beneficial home remedy for dry cough.
  • Dryness in the nasal passageway caused the chest infection to be worse. Inhalation of the steam soothes the airway and loosens the mucus. Add few droplets of essential oil to boiling water and inhale it for 3-7 minutes. Try to cover your head with a slightly wet towel. This will help to expel the coughing up blood out.
  • Drink Lotus root juice two times a day for a week is proved to be very useful in hemoptysis.
  • Take 15 grams of mulberry leaves, dry Lilly bulbs, .washed it and mix with 9 grams of a wood cup. Then boil it within water until half of the water remains, and Drink it two times a day regularly.
  • Take the mixture of 30g of hedgehog flowers within 60 g carriage leaves, boil in water until half of the water remains. Regular use of this mixture is very effective against coughing up blood

  • Prospan is a herbal cough syrup that is more effective against severe cough and respiratory infections. It is alcohol-free, sugar-free, and free of artificial colors that are effective for adults and children.
  • Take an equal amount of Gotu kola and weed roots as 60 g. then add 30g of ranging in it and boil in 800 ccs of water until half of the water evaporates. Drink this water twice a day.
  • Few herbs aid in clearing lungs and make breathing easy. These include Mullein, Horehound, Ginseng, Osha Root, and Eucalyptus. All these herbs are the active components of cough syrup. They have antimicrobial activity as some fight against gram-positive and gram-negative bacteria. Some have anti-inflammatory properties that work against inflammation. These herbs help in the removal of mucus from the lungs. They are also helpful against allergies and chest infections. The natural herbs boost the immune system and provide relief from irritated tissues of the respiratory tract.

In this way, all the above herbal medicines and home remedies for dry cough are beneficial in mitigating the symptoms of coughing up blood. In case of any severity, I always advise the patient to contact their doctor to be treated accordingly. So, if you are suffering from coughing up blood, you can seek medical help through these herbs online shop.

Apart from these remedies, one should take these preventive measures, like:
  • Avoid smoking as it affects your immune system. Quit smoking will help to boost your immunity so that you can get relief.
  • Maintaining appropriate personal hygiene is also very beneficial.
  • In case of chest infection, practicing social distancing can help as well.



Coughing up blood is a contagious disease. This coughing out blood is alarming as it could signify a serious condition like lung cancer coughing up blood, damaged blood vessels, and infection. Regardless of symptoms, it doesn’t matter whether the blood amount is large or small; it indicates the symptoms of a severe disease that need to be treated. For this purpose, many synthetic approaches are practiced to treat the condition. But some side effects appear during medical treatment. So there is a need for an effective way, and all these above natural home remedies are the best alternative for coughing up blood treatment. Fortunately, there are some online herb shops or Hakeem Pakistan that provide these herbal medicines. They also offer the facility to buy online herbal products.


